Output 0877cf651cc526b2d4f853a30e673f14d02ca1660157801e136c34d6a7b5a8b7:0

value
5478519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3391f0095bcc3e16002438f05f2530cb2d5e70c9 OP_EQUAL
address
36PhDFaxpbaaNqNTtYGfQXMPqkGpQCumaW
transaction
0877cf651cc526b2d4f853a30e673f14d02ca1660157801e136c34d6a7b5a8b7
spent
true